Output 75eac1cd223113e6a9f4a3dbca0eb83d672bd65f4ae1eccbd93131663dbf52c3:1

value
2963558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f117f7ca087d916cd13e85f7d647f42a002c8a OP_EQUAL
address
3L1VtPVMauArc74xG4PHXofSKgG4vMP7Ea
transaction
75eac1cd223113e6a9f4a3dbca0eb83d672bd65f4ae1eccbd93131663dbf52c3
confirmations
368555
spent
true